BoomPrime Adjustment (optional)

The BoomPrime system works within a fixed pressure range of around 3 bar, but must be adjusted for the specific spray job
(different choice of nozzles etc.):
1. Unfold the boom and start the PTO.
2. Set pressure SmartValve to "Spraying", suction valve to "Main
tank" and agitation valve to "Agitation".
3. Adjust the spray pressure to what will be used when spraying.
4. Turn the BoomPrime adjuster screw (A) to increase the
BoomPrime pressure to 3 bar or until the nozzles start to leak.
5. If nozzles leak, then lower the BoomPrime pressure by 1 bar on the
adjuster screw (A).
μ
ATTENTION! If not adjusted correctly, nozzles will not close (i.e.
will leak) when the spraying is stopped or it will not prime the
tubes.
The possible priming circulation speed of BoomPrime relies on the non-
drip valves to keep the nozzles closed. If an extended amount circulation
may be necessary, the non-drip valves can be changed to a version with
higher pressure setting (later opening time).
